mIRC Font: Fixedsys Excelsior
v3.01 NoLiga
This is the defacto (unofficial) TrueType FIXEDSYS font for mIRC.
Use it instead of the FIXEDSYS system bitmap font that only supports 169 characters, now deprecated by Windows.
Fixedsys Excelsior 3.01 includes thousands of unicode characters for over a dozen languages.

Review: maroon
This lets you have the Fixedsys font at more sizes than the original FIxedsys gives. At the same font size offered by Fixedsys, the ASCII text is basically the same.
You'll need to test various sizes to see if they work for you. At some sizes, the characters have a shadowing effect that can affect visibility.
If using this as your scripts editor font, it gives a visible [B] [C] [O] for the Ctrl+B Ctrl+K and Ctrl+O hotekeys. What would make it even more useful would be if it gave [R] [U] [I] symbols for the Ctrl+R Ctrl+U and Ctrl+I symbols too.
While it does map additional unicode characters, this can be a drawback in programs which do font linking. For example, the chess pieces icons don't exist in Fixedsys, so it font-links for them. In NoLiga, it contains icons for the chess pieces which are not the same quality as the ones in MsGothic, so the Queen looks like a profile of Bart SImpson.
Example: //echo -a $replace(R N B Q K B N R,R,$chr(9814),N,$chr(9816),B,$chr(9815),Q,$chr(9813),K,$chr(9812))
If your queen looks like Bart without using any Excelsior font, mIRC font-links the "Fixedsys Excelsior 3.01" font name without the 'No Liga", so you can uninstall that font name and install this font name, and be able to use this font without it affecting your font linking.
